Jmeter----读取excel表中的数据

Jmeter 读取excel数据使用的方法是使用CSV Data Set Config参数化,之后使用BeanShell Sampler来读取excel表中的数据

第一步、查看所需的接口都要哪些字段和值

            

 

第二步、excel表中填写所需的数据

         

 

第三步、添加CSV Data Set Config,可以允许从你输入的路径来读取文件,然后根据分隔符获取到数据。

  

 

CSV Data Set Config中的填写配置

字段释义说明:

  Filename:保存的excel表格的名字,保存的格式为CSV,参数化文件的读取位置。这个路径可以是绝对路径也是可以相对路径。在分布式测试中,还是利用相对路径

         比较方便,因为有的机器可能安装路径不一样。

  File encoding:excel表的保存编码

  Variable Names(comma-delimited):变量名称,(多个变量名称以逗号隔开。例如username,passwd)一般写excel表格的首行字段名称,如上我截图所示

  Ignore first line(only used if Variable Names is not empty):是否忽略第一行数据,如我上图excel表的截图,则选:True,实际的请求值从excel表的第二行开始

  Delimiter:分隔符,默认逗号

  Allow quoted data:是非选项,是否允许变量中间有分隔符,这里最好先默认false,数据中间最好不要有分隔符。

  Recycle on EOF和Stop thread on EOF按需设置。是否循环,到结尾是否停止测试

  Sharing mode:先选择所有的线程都可以利用此参数化。

 

第四步、添加采样器:BeanShell Sampler

  路径:线程---右键--添加---sample--beanshell sample

  用途:可以使用Java语法规范和内置变量来编写所需的脚本

  

 

备注说明:常用的内置变量

  

第五步、再次添加Debug sampler

  用途:可以在运行结束后,查看所取的对应值是否正确

  

 

以上就完成了excel中数据的读取,若读取多行值,比如以上截图中我们要读取2行值,那么,我们需要设置:线程数 即可

 

 

 

  

 

 

 

 

posted @   Syw_文  阅读(3091)  评论(0编辑  收藏  举报
编辑推荐:
· AI与.NET技术实操系列(二):开始使用ML.NET
· 记一次.NET内存居高不下排查解决与启示
· 探究高空视频全景AR技术的实现原理
· 理解Rust引用及其生命周期标识(上)
· 浏览器原生「磁吸」效果!Anchor Positioning 锚点定位神器解析
阅读排行:
· DeepSeek 开源周回顾「GitHub 热点速览」
· 物流快递公司核心技术能力-地址解析分单基础技术分享
· .NET 10首个预览版发布:重大改进与新特性概览!
· AI与.NET技术实操系列(二):开始使用ML.NET
· 单线程的Redis速度为什么快?
点击右上角即可分享
微信分享提示